The thing that gets me though is how good some folks make their clones sound. Listening to the Flower Kings live DVD, and hearing his Hammond tone, I kept waiting to see a shot of the keyboardist to see what he was using. And I was impressed that it was a Nord Electro (and he had a VK7 up there as well that he was using as a controller for his rack...he played the Hammond bits on the lil Red Corvette).
Transatlantic's Live DVD sports great organ tone, and it's just a VK7 (his rack was very small, and didn't look to carry anything but an Akai Sampler triggered from his Alesis QS8.
If you have a sound that inspires you....it makes all the difference. Even to us musicians, if it's in the ballpark, we're more interested in what the music is saying than how it's saying it....although, we can't ignore how its being said can we? :-)
